Brighton and Hove Albion: A Rising Force in Premier League Football

In the recent years, Brighton and Hove Albion Football Club has etched its name as a rising force in English Premier League football. This club, based in the vibrant seaside city of Brighton, has made significant strides both on and off the pitch, capturing the hearts of fans and catching the attention of football enthusiasts around the world.

Brighton and Hove Albion, also known as the Seagulls, have come a long way since their humble beginnings over a century ago. Established in 1901, the club has experienced its fair share of ups and downs, competing in various divisions of English football. However, it was not until 2017 that Brighton finally reached the pinnacle of English football and gained promotion to the Premier League under the guidance of their talented manager, Chris Hughton.

What sets Brighton and Hove Albion apart is their commitment to building a sustainable football club. While many newly promoted teams often face a daunting struggle for survival in the Premier League, Brighton has managed to establish themselves as a solid mid-table team, avoiding relegation and consistently improving their performances. Their shrewd investments in players and infrastructure have allowed them to compete with some of the giants of English football.

The club’s home ground, the American Express Community Stadium, commonly known as the Amex, is a remarkable feat of modern footballing architecture. The state-of-the-art facility boasts a seating capacity of over 30,000 and provides a fantastic matchday experience for fans. As a testament to its sustainability, the stadium is hailed as one of the most environmentally friendly in the United Kingdom.

The on-field success of Brighton and Hove Albion can be attributed to their meticulous approach to player recruitment. The club has an astute scouting network that has identified talented players from across the globe, many of whom have flourished under the guidance of the coaching staff. Notable signings such as striker Neal Maupay and midfielder Pascal Gross have played crucial roles in the team’s recent successes.

Under the current manager, Graham Potter, Brighton has continued to evolve and play an attractive brand of football that focuses on attacking prowess and fluidity. Potter’s tactical acumen and the team’s commitment to his philosophy have led to some impressive performances against top-flight opponents, often leaving fans in awe of their style and determination.

Off the pitch, Brighton and Hove Albion have also made significant strides. The club’s commitment to inclusivity and community engagement is commendable. They run various programs aimed at promoting grassroots football, supporting local charities, and enhancing the football experience for fans of all ages. Their dedication to being a club for all, regardless of background, has garnered widespread admiration and respect.

Brighton and Hove Albion’s journey from lower league obscurity to being a rising force in the Premier League is a testament to their resilience, hard work, and passionate fan base. Their commitment to sustainable growth, investment in infrastructure, and cultivating a strong team spirit has positioned them as an exciting club with a bright future.

As they continue to challenge some of the Premier League’s established powerhouses, Brighton and Hove Albion have firmly cemented their place as a team to watch. With a clear vision and a dedicated team, their rise up the ranks of English football is set to continue, captivating fans and proving that even the underdogs can compete with the best.
